DRAFTING & PLANNING- PROP IDEAS
 I'm going to need various of props within my trailer I am going to label the essential props that are
definitely going to be featured in my trailer. Some of my props I can create myself while others I will need to
purchase.
REALISTIC BB GUN:
I want to purchase a realistic BB gun as the plot is that my main protagonist is going to murders her boyfriend
and a form of weaponry needs to be included. As I want my trailer to be professional the gun would have to
look as realistic as possible. I am planning to take a couple of shots featuring the gun. I see ranges in prices
some from £6- £30 on different websites from Ebay to Amazon and official Company BB gun websites.
However, a cheaper option if the gun would go over my budget would be a kitchen knife. This will be equally
as effective and it will also do the job. The only different is with the gun it causes more suspense and I will
have more options to play around with sound effects. Or to create suspense in the trailer shots where she's
pointing the gun at him. Depending on how much everything like my location and all the other props will
determine which one I will get.
DRAFTING & PLANNING- PROP IDEAS
 FAKE BLOOD & KOOLAID:
Once again as violence and murder is an integral role within my plot conventions such as blood are going to be featured quite a lot. I need to
use fake blood I am purchasing and creating this. Fake blood is ranging online as cheap as 43p to £12.99. I have decided to both purchase fake
blood and also decide to make my own because the fake blood is this realistic, professional consistency it has the right colour an texture to
realistically represent blood as the blood is planning to go on the floor and the wall etc. However, I will need to purchase KOOLAID as there is
going to be a blood scene bath and Kool-Aid is an really red concentrated powdered drink I used in in my preliminary and one packet made
the water vibrant read and it represented someone bleeding out in the bath the packet is as cheap as £1. This will effectively create a realistic
blood bath.
HANDCUFFS:
I am using handcuffs to represent a crime and show the severity of
of the crime. The handcuff will cause suspense as it will leave the audience
curious as to who's being arrested. As I want my trailer to be realistic I am using real handcuffs
I know a police officer due to family links and I have emailed him if he can feature and if I can use
some of his equipment in the trailer. He has to ask a higher management and they confirm whether
he can do this but handcuffs are integral and I'm able to use actual handcuffs so my prop is of high
quality which will make my trailer appear more professional.
DRAFTING & PLANNING- PROP IDEAS
 COLOURED LIGHT BULBS
The colour red has a lot of representations such as danger, sexiness, romance it is even associated with death and blood. Because I am
creating a romantic thriller I want my trailer to appear eerie so it creates suspense so I have decided to purchase coloured lights. It can give
me various of effects it can appear eerie. Or even replicate police lights. They are relatively cheap only £4 for separate coloured bulbs and
£7.90 for different coloured flashing bulbs. This is not too expensive and the effect it will have on my trailer makes it worthwhile.
PICTURE FRAME:
A picture frame is another of the prop I am going to use. This is ideally to show a happy picture of
the couple which is going to fall and break to represent the downfall of their relationship. Picture
frames are extremely cheap so the price will not be an issue or above my budget. I have a couple of
picture frames at home but I want to use one that is glass so I can show the glass breaking.
IPHONE:
I’m using an IPhone for the prop I don’t have to purchase this as both me and my actors already have them. The iPhone is essential as
there are scenes where the phone has to be featured. Like the unknown call. The text message on the phone. The dialling of 911. This
prop will make my film not look as low budget as its an expensive equipment.
DRAFTING & PLANNING- PROP IDEAS
 ROSES/ ROSE PETALS:
Roses are essential for my trailer. The prices of roses can vary a dozen will probably be like £10+. I will buy these when I'm going to film
the scene because as roses are flowers they tend to die quickly and I want to be able to shoot them while they are vibrant and alive. I
need in general about 2-3 rose I need a singular rose so I can burn. Roses has many connotations associated with love and romance and
burning a rose symbolises the end of a love. I then need another rose for rose petals to put in a bath.
WINE GLASSES & BOTTLE:
Another prop is wine glasses and bottles like the rose it has connotations of romance and love. This fine dining ideology.
I have The one glass will be a nice shot and make my trailer appear more sophisticate and it’s a form of opulence.
LAPTOP WITH A WEBCAM:
Another prop I need is a laptop with a webcam this is important because it needs to show how the girlfriend is secretly still watching her
ex which is a form of possession.
